I wanted to become a soldier but changed my mind when Manasa Bari lifted the Melrose Cup – Nagasau

By Dhanjay Deo , Krishneel Nair
21/04/2022
Fiji Airways Fijiana 7s team captain, Rusila Nagasau

Fiji Airways Fijiana 7s team captain, Rusila Nagasau says growing as a child, she always wanted to become a soldier however she changed her mind when she saw her cousin, Manasa Bari lift the Melrose Cup in 1997.

Nagasau who is originally from Vakativa, Cakaudrove says she initially did not have rugby as part of her dream.

The 34-year-old has told fijivillage that she also has been inspired by former Fiji 7s reps, Aisake Katonibau and Viliame Satala.

Nagasau says after moving from Tavua to Suva, she played rugby with boys during recess and lunch time at St Agnes Primary School.

She later played soccer in secondary school and forced her way into the Fiji Under 20 soccer team in 2006.

Nagasau who resumed playing rugby in 2007 says her dream is to win the women’s competition in the Hong Kong 7s.

The Fijian 7s team is in Pool C with England, USA and New Zealand for the Langford 7s which will be held next week.
